Why is there no letter under the date on your 1889 silver dollar?

Because the mint mark location on Morgan dollars is on the reverse side of the coin, above the DO in DOLLAR. Mint marks didn't appear on the front of $1 coins until 1971. Possible letters for an 1889 dollar are: Blank = Philadelphia O = New Orleans S = San Francisco CC = Carson City

Where is the mint mark on an 1889 liberty dollar coin?

I'm not certain which coin you are wanting to know about. In 1889 there were no coins to my knowledge called "liberty dollar". However, there was a gold dollar minted that year which was minted in Philadelphia and therefore carries no mint mark. None were minted anywhere else. Also in 1889 there was a silver dollar minted called "Morgan Dollar" . The mint mark on this one is located below the wreath on the reverse side of the coin. These were minted in Carson City, Nevada and carried a "CC" mint mark: New Orleans, Louisiana and carried an "O" mint mark: San Francisco, California and carried an "S" mint mark: Philadelphia, Pennsylvania and carried no mint mark at all.
